ComDesFlotOne
CONFIDENTIAL
U. S. S. RALEIGH, Flagship
Pearl Harbor, T.H., 12 SEPT 1941
1.Repainting of ships of Destroyer Division NINE plus PORTER (DD356) will be carried out in accordance with paragraph 2 of reference (a). 2.Commander, Destoryer Squadron FIVE is directed to designate the ships on which the measures listed will be applied. Inform Commander Destroyers, Battle Force and the Flotilla Commander as to the names of the ships designated, with copy to the information adressees. It is noted that Commander Destroyer Squadron FIVE has designated the DRAYTON (DD366) for Measure 1B. 3.Direct ships to excercise care in preparing the surface for painting especially if painting over old dark gray paint. Two complete coats should be applied and sufficient additional paint obtained to permit periodic re-touching after departure from the Navy Yard.
R. A. THEOBALD Copies To: |
